ISO 535-2014 pdf free.Paper and board – Determination of water absorptiveness – Cobb method.
ISO 535 specifies a method of determining the water absorptivencss of sized paper and board, including corrugated fibreboard, under standard conditions. It may not be suitable for paper ofgrammage less than 50 g/m2 or embossed paper. It is not suitable for porous papers such as newsprint or unsized papers such as blotting paper or other papers having a relatively high water absorptiveness for which ISO 8787121 is more suitable.
This method is not intended to be used for precise evaluation of the writing properties of paper although it does give a general indication of suitability for use with aqueous inks.

3 Terms and definitions
For the purposes of this document, the following terms and definitions apply.
3.1
water absorptiveness (Cobb value)
calculated mass of water absorbed in a specified time by 1 m2 of paper or board under specified conditions
Note I to entry: The test area Is normally 100 cm2.
4 Principle
A test piece is weighed immediately before and immediately after exposure for a specified time of one surface to water, followed by blotting. The result of the increase in mass is expressed in grams per square metre (g/m2).
5 Reagents and materials
5.1 Water, distilled or deionized. The temperature of the water is important and should be maintained during the test at the temperature used for conditioning and testing.
5.2 Blotting paper, having a grammage of 250 g/m2土25 g/m2. Pulp evaluation blotters are acceptable for the purposes of this International Standard (see ISO 5269-1).
6 Apparatus
6.1 Absorptiveness tester for the determination of water absorptiveness.
Any type of apparatus may be used which permts
— an immediate and uniform contact of the water with the part of the test piece submitted to the test;
— controlled rapid removal of the unabsorbed water from the test piece at the end of the contact period; and
— the rapid removal of the test piece without the risk of contact with water outside the test area.
In its simplest form, the apparatus consists of a rigid base with a smooth, planar surface, and a rigid metal cylinder of 112,8 mm ± 0.2 mm internal diameter (corresponding to a test area approximately 100 cm2) and with a means of clamping It firmly to the base plate. The edge of the cylinder in contact with the test piece shall be flat and machined smooth with a thickness sufficient to prevent the cylinder cutting into the test piece.
